Are transfer workshops at Queens College worth attending?

I've heard about transfer workshops at Queens College. Do these workshops provide valuable information and support, or are they not as helpful as they seem? I want to make the most of my transfer experience.

a year ago

Attending transfer workshops at Queens College, or any college really, can be quite beneficial, especially if you're navigating the transfer process for the first time. These workshops often cover key aspects of transferring, such as understanding transfer credits, choosing the right classes for your major, getting to know the campus resources, and dealing with administrative tasks like enrollment and registration.

In addition, these workshops typically offer the opportunity to meet other transfer students, which can help you build a support network and understand that you're not alone in this transition. The chance to ask direct questions to the workshop facilitators, who are often experienced transfer advisors, can also be quite valuable.

Remember, everyone's needs and circumstances are unique, and what works for one person may not work for you. So, if you're unsure about whether it's worth it to attend, you might try reaching out to the coordinator or the college's transfer office for more details about what will be covered in the workshop. Also, you could try finding feedback from former or current students about their experiences, which might give you a clearer idea about the benefits of these workshops.
